Veronica Mars season 5 not happening (for now) at Hulu

Is Veronica Mars ending, and this time for good? There are questions about it right now, especially in the wake of new reports.

According to a new story courtesy of TVLine, it appears as though there are no plans for a season 5 at the moment at Hulu, months removed from the eight-episode fourth season premiered on the streaming service. That was a product that a lot of viewers out there were eager to behold — yet, it ended up being one of the most polarizing seasons in recent history. What happened? A lot of it comes down to the key Logan decision in the closing minutes, one that rocked most of the internet from the moment that it was first witnessed.

At the time the moment happened, one of the quotes that we kept hearing, time and time again, was how this was the right way to push the story forward. Yet, how can that happen if there is no more story coming at all? It’s possible that the ending caused plans for the future to stall out; or, it’s also possible that this is just something that will take a lot of time to come together. Remember that Kristen Bell has a number of other jobs, including the final season of The Good Place airing right now.

Despite however polarizing the fourth season of Veronica Mars may have been, we definitely don’t think that it means the end of the road for the series as a whole — even if there is no plan for another season right now.
